Preparation steps
- grease well a square-shaped refractory dish, the size as in the picture, and cover the bottom with bread as follows: take the toast and cut it in half so that you get 2 halves; the reason for such cutting is to more easily arrange in a refractory container; so fill the bottom of your bowl with toast (when you cut you get two triangles of bread, arrange it all along the bottom of the fireproof dish)
- cut the chicory into sticks; chop onion, garlic and parsley; saute the chopped spices and onions in a pan with the rest of the butter and oil; add the chicory and simmer for about 10 minutes
- switch to a refractory bowl: after mixing the cheeses, sprinkle them over the bread that is in the refractory dish, but only half of the cheese mixture; then put a uniform mixture of chicory and only then the rest of the cheese
- in a separate bowl, whisk together the egg and milk, add a little salt and a little grated nutmeg; pour this over the mixture in a fireproof dish
- push the refractory bowl into the oven at 200 degrees for 30 minutes; remove from oven when yellowed
